usurpers26 26 Posted April 24, 2007 The only differences are the 120gb drive and HDMI...supposedly it runs cooler but my premium has never has a heat issue so I'm not taking into consideration the "cooler running" factor. Unless you think you'll fill up the 20gb drive on the premium - I don't know if it's worth it. Yes, HDMI avoids a DAC - but most people can't see the difference and the sound capabilities are a moot point since most people connect directly to a receiver. I would buy it if wifi was built in as well as the rumored 65nm chips...but that's just me. listen to surferskin. The elite is like $80 more, but you get soooo much more.
